Ion irradiation and implantation modifications of magneto-ionically induced exchange bias in Gd/NiCoO

Magneto-ionic control of magnetic properties through ionic migration has shown promise in enabling new functionalities energy-efficient spintronic devices. In this work, we demonstrate the effect helium ion irradiation and oxygen implantation on magneto-ionically induced exchange bias Gd/Ni$_{0.33}$Co$_{0.67}$O heterostructures. Irradiation using $He^+$ leads to an expansion Ni$_{0.33}$Co$_{0.67}$O lattice due strain relaxation. At low He+ fluence ($\leq$ 2$\times$10$^{14}$ ions cm$^{-2}$), redox-induced interfacial moment initially increases, owing enhanced migration. higher fluence, is suppressed reduction pinned uncompensated spins. For implanted samples, initial below a dose 5$\times$10$^{15}$ cm$^{-2}$ subsequently dominated at by contraction phase segregation into NiO CoO-rich phases, which turn alters bias. These results highlight possibility as effective means tailor magneto-ionic effects.
